Data Examples
Intracellular Staining by Flow Cytometry | Detection of HIF‑1 alpha in MCF‑7 Human Cell Line by Flow Cytometry. MCF‑7 human breast cancer cell line treated with CoCl2 was stained with Mouse Anti-Human/Mouse HIF‑1 alpha PE‑conjugated Monoclonal Antibody (Catalog # IC1935P, filled histogram) or isotype control antibody (Catalog # , open histogram). To facilitate intracellular staining, cells were fixed with Flow Cytometry Fixation Buffer (Catalog # ) and permeabilized with Flow Cytometry Permeabilization/Wash Buffer I (Catalog # ). Background: HIF-1 alpha
The hypoxia-inducible transcription factor 1 alpha (HIF-1 alpha ) is the regulated member of the transcription factor heterodimer HIF-1. HIF-1 binds to hypoxia-response elements (HREs) in the promoters of many genes involved in adapting to an environment of insufficient oxygen or hypoxia. Hypoxic tissue environments occur in vascular and pulmonary diseases as well as cancer, which illustrates the broad impact of gene regulation by HIF-1 alpha.
